Cocoas

/ˈkoʊkoʊz/ noun

Definition

Plural of cocoa; multiple cocoa plants, cocoa beans, or servings of cocoa drink.

Etymology

From Spanish 'cacao,' which came from Nahuatl (Aztec) 'kakawatl.' The plural 'cocoas' refers to multiple individual instances of cocoa plants, beans, or beverages.
